沃尔沃挖掘机操作方法

沃尔沃挖掘机操作方法沃尔沃挖掘机是一种常见的工程挖掘设备,广泛应用于建筑、矿山、道路施工等领域。
下面我将详细介绍沃尔沃挖掘机的操作方法。
1. 准备工作:在操作沃尔沃挖掘机之前,首先要确保设备处于正常工作状态。
检查油液、液压系统、电气系统等设备是否正常。
清理挖斗、履带等部件上的污垢。
检查油液是否符合标准要求,如需要添加或更换,应进行相应的操作。
确保挖掘机周围没有人员、障碍物等安全隐患。
2. 上车操作:操作人员应穿着符合安全要求的工作服、安全帽和安全带。
用钥匙启动发动机,然后将左手放在驾驶室左边的操作台上,右手放在仪表盘旁边的控制杆上。
将左脚放在减震器上,右脚放在油门踏板上。
当发动机正常运行时,档位插入中性(N),同时观察仪表盘上各个指示灯是否正常。
3. 挖掘操作:(1)启动油门:将油门踏板踩到底,逐渐增加发动机转速。
同时观察油门踏板的位置指示是否恰当。
(2)动作选择:根据实际情况选择挖斗下沉(或称下松)或挖斗卸载的动作。
挖斗下沉可以将挖斗松土,挖斗卸载则是将挖掘好的土方放置到相应的地方。
(3)挖斗动作:将挖斗的四个控制杆放在合适的位置上,控制挖斗的上升、下降、伸缩和旋转。
操作时要保持控制杆平稳,避免剧烈晃动。
(4)旋转操作:通过控制杆控制挖斗的旋转方向和速度,使挖斗能够按照所需方向进行旋转。
(5)摆动操作:通过控制杆控制挖掘机左右两侧履带的差速,使挖掘机能够左右移动。
操作时要注意方向和速度的控制,避免碰撞障碍物。
(6)充填操作:在挖斗卸载过程中,操作人员要根据实际情况控制挖斗的卸载速度和位置,确保土方能够平稳地卸载到指定的地方。
4. 关车操作:停车前,先将挖斗放置到安全位置,断开控制杆和油门踏板的连接。
然后将控制杆放回中性位置,将挡位插入中性(N)。
关闭发动机,取下开关钥匙,步行下车。
总结起来,沃尔沃挖掘机操作方法包括准备工作、上车操作、挖掘操作和关车操作等步骤。
在操作过程中,操作人员应注意安全,熟练掌握各个控制杆的操作方法。

选车就选性价比高的12-15吨挖掘机大搜罗(系列二)[铁甲工程机械网原创] 12-15吨中小型挖掘机在挖掘机家族中占有重要一席,因为其上可承担“重活”,下可揽小工程的特点,被不少用户所青睐。
在国内外诸多厂家当中,这个范围内的挖掘机精品可以说是层出不穷,上篇铁甲工程机械网介绍了小松、日立、神钢的三款12-13吨挖掘机,具体参见《还在发愁买哪款车?12-15吨挖掘机大搜罗(系列一)》、《国产机器不可小觑12-15吨挖掘机搜罗(系列三)》。
这次将为大家呈现的是三款性价比不错的挖掘机--沃尔沃EC140BLC prime、现代R150LC-7、斗山DH150LC-7。
沃尔沃EC140BLC prime整机工作重量:13800kg铲斗容量:0.55-0.93m³作为全球前三的沃尔沃建筑设备近年来非常重视中国市场,刚刚落幕的沃尔沃掘战达人节油挑战赛显示了沃尔沃贴近中国用户需求的心理。
原装的EC140BLC prime在用户心目中的形象是“性能可靠,耐用”。
虽然价格上被用户笑称“贵族”机器,但是对于一些资金比较充足的用户来讲这款机器还是可圈可点的。
机身保持了沃尔沃厚重大气的风格,防滑梯和平台采用冲孔钢板,在有水或者结冰的情况下也可以安全防滑。
底盘采用LC型,更加稳定,涂漆采用无铅表层油漆,符合环保要求。
沃尔沃的驾驶室很舒服,比较宽敞,驾驶室采用减震装置减轻操作员的疲劳。
操作手柄很轻,动作较快,尤其是旋转动作,各个动作的连贯性值得称赞。
“安全”是沃尔沃挖掘机一直以来主打口号,大小臂钢材是经过强化的,延长使用寿命。
结合多位用户的使用体验,这款EC140BLC prime工作中省油,每小时7-9升(租赁工作),但是有个缺点,没有小油门,而且沃尔沃机器对油特别“挑剔”,这也是其“贵族”称号的另一个由来,在中国如今油品质量状况下下,用户调侃道,省油下来的钱全都买好油了。
但是不可辩驳的是,其省油耐用的品质仍是值得用户信赖的。

涡轮增压器
检查所有涡轮增压器的进气和排气接接口,以确保它们已 拧紧,并处于正确的位置。
涡轮增压器在极高的温度下运行,因此,在维修时要格外 小心。
涡轮增压器通过发动机润滑系统进行润滑和冷却。
确保涡轮发动机正常工作需要注意以下几个重点:
• 通过以下两种方式确保润滑和冷却:
– 启动发动机后不要立即加速。
– 在关闭发动机前要让其低怠速运转几分钟。
如果含硫量达 5%(或更高),则需每隔 125 小时排放一次发动机 油以获得最长的发动机使用寿命。
对目前的高压燃油系统来说,柴油清洁度满足 EPA 规定至关重要。
根据厂商的建议,更换燃油过滤器非常重要。

TH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COMEMEETING THE FUTURE’S DEMANDS WITH THE TECHNOLOGY OF TOMORROWThe p hilosop hy of Volvo is characterizedby Quality, Safety and Environmental Care.While these common values are peoplecentered, they also create great demandson the products that Volvo CE produces.In order to lead the industry in quality,safety and care for the environment, theequipment Volvo CE designs and manu-factures must be at the leading edge oftechnological development.This brochure examines the workof a team of industrial designersin their quest to design theVolvo Construction Equip-ment excavator of the 2020s.With the corporate values at thecore of the design philosophy,the end result – the SfinX exca-vator — is a symbol not only ofVolvo’s advanced technological thin-king, but also of where the companywants to go in its search for product excel-lence and customer intimacy.2TH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COMESfinX: guardian of the futureThe SfinX project was the brainchild of Volvo CE’s Product Portfolio andAdvanced Engineering department. Working closely with Swedish industrialdesign house, “Prospective Design” and Volvo Group’s T echnology Centre, theteam talked to operators about what features they would like to see on newmachines. In addition, the designers also looked outside of the constructionindustry to search for emergent technologies that could have applicationssuitable to construction equipment. The automotive and aerospace sectorsprovided rich pickings, as did laboratories and universities.The excavator was chosen as the subject of the research, as this is themost competitive sector of the construction equipment market, and also themost popular piece. The SfinX team was not taking the easy option.While still recognizable as an excavator,almost every component has been radicallyaltered. The engine is no longer diesel but asmall fuel cell, which produces electric energy –but emits only heat and water vapor. This freesup space in the superstructure and allows theengine to perform as an ‘active counterweight’,which moves in and out to compensate for theforces on the boom. Hydraulics have been largely replaced and there hasbeen extensive use of new materials – not all of which are available todayand will need ‘inventing’. In fact, some of the technology may never come tofruition – while other aspects (e.g. GPS) are available today. “We had to guesssometimes,” says Hans Zachau, chief designer on the SfinX project. “But that’sthe whole idea – to imagine possible outcomes. We learned not to be scaredof new technology and radical concepts and have had the courage to includethem in the SfinX.”Hungry to digThe final design of the excavator is a mixture between space ageand primordial, like a prehistoric moon buggy.The animalistic look isintentional; SfinX should be efficient, lean and hungry to dig. Purposeful anda little mean looking. But it’s still a Volvo machine and therefore must reflectthe core values of Quality, Safety and Environmental Care. It has the familiaroutline of an excavator but the design updates current concepts of boom,cab, tracks and superstructure in an innovative way. The familiar Volvo logoand color scheme tie the design back to the current machines. The reduceduse of hydraulics helps to achieve a cleaner looking, more attractive design.The excavator was chosen as the subject of the research.TH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COME 3Power packThe future machines will no longer use diesel engines. The designers toyed with the idea of using gas turbines (effectively jet engines) but settled on the idea of fuel cells. Fuel cells convert a fuel’s energy into usable electricity and heat – without combustion. Because hydrogen reacts with oxygen to produce electricity, it is the optimal fuel to use, as its only emissions are water vapor and heat. They are like batteries that don’t run down as long as you keep feeding them hydrogen. The hydrogen is stored in liquid form at very low temperatures (circa. -45°C).Fuel cells are currently in the development stage (although the automotive industry has working prototypes under eva-luation) but it has been calculated that to power an excavator, a fuel cell the size of two normal suitcases would be needed. This frees up a lot of space on the superstructure where the diesel engine would normally sit – hence the machine’s ability to have such a large cutaway section. The engine acts as the machine counter weight, which moves all the time to com-pensate for the forces on the boom. By moving it towards the centre of the excavator, it could be made small for transport, moving it right out would give maximum stability. (Zero swing or large swing.)Increasingly onerous emission legislations are also likely to speed up the move to hydrogen cells – a most environmen-tally friendly power system.4TH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COMEFluid thinkingor electric ideas?The introduction of electricity could also do awaywith hydraulics. All systems that are currentlyhydraulic could be converted to electric motors.Notice how hydraulic cylinders have been re-moved as much as possible and hydraulic pipingabandoned. This would obviate the need to cir-culate oil all over the machine. Hydraulics is anold technology but it still has some life yet. Volvobelieves that gradually hydraulic cylinders maybe phased out and replaced by electric motorssited at the pivot points of the stick & boom.Boom boonThe central concept was to make a light boom – because everything in weight on the boom is lost in capacity for lifting or digging. The see-through lattice allows visibility through the boom, aiding safety by reducing the operator’s blind spot caused by solid metal booms. While current steels would struggle to cope with the large forces imposed on the boom, the designer are expecting a new generation of high strengthsteels to be available that could make this a design possibility.Independent thinkingThe adoption of four tracks is to make them more wheel-like. When driving on rough ground traditional tracks ‘tiptoe’ and the contact area is quite small. Four tracks have a much higher contact area with the ground, aided by independent suspension to each track, suspended via a swing arm from a central pivot. Each track has a separate wheel motor, which can brake, accelerate and allow the track to steer the excavator . On traditional tracks you either brake or accelerate, left or right. Tracks will also use a non-metal rubber-like material that can cope with high abrasion surfaces. The four tracks can be moved to form a traditional two track appearance to distribute the weight better when on soft ground. This system (also powered by electric motors) can be used to extend the tracks outwards for increased stability while working –or inwards under the superstructure for transportation.TH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COME 5The engine acts as themachine counter weight,which moves all the timeto compensate forthe forces on the boom.6TH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COMEThe SfinX excavator hovers on an electro-magnetic field.Drive-By-WireAnother area where aerospace is developing new technologies of interest to the SfinX team is ‘fly-by-wire’. This is where there is no physical link (solid cables, mechanical links or hydraulic piping) between the driver controls and the components they operate. Instead commands are sent ‘wirelessly’ to sensors on the components or via electric wires. In construction machinery this would enable the eradication of hydraulic or mechanical controls and the replacement with electronic and electrical controls. These systems, like on aircraft, would have multiple ‘redundancy’ on critical systems, such as brakes and steering,whereby a secondary back-up system would not only ensure constant perfor-mance, but also enhance safety. The coming generation of excavators,graders and wheel loaders is likely to feature some form of drive-by-wire.It has potential applications in braking, steering and moving the boom.Legislation will also play a part in determining when drive-by-wire becomes a reality.Are customers demanding drive-by-wire? Customers are demanding soft levers and easy to use controls – and drive-by-wire allows this to happen.Drive-by-wire also eliminates the need for hydraulic oil to be piped into the cab – which can get very hot (thereby heating up the cab).Houston: we have a solution Satellite technology is already available and will become much more popular in the future. Volvo CE is working on GPS (Global Positioning System) basedtelematic capabilities for its future pro-duct range. ‘Geo-fencing’ can make sure that a machine doesn’t leave a prede-termined area – sounding an alarm and incapacitating the machine if necessary.Also data such as hours worked, tem-perature, fuel consumption and produc-tivity information can all be captured.This not only helps prepare service pro-grams, but also highlights machine misuse/abuse and enables equipment owners to calculate lifetime ownership costs. Real time fleet management is now a reality. GPS also has operational advantages. For example, in excavators or graders, GPS information can help to notify the operator how the bucket or blade should be placed so that only the precise amount of material is remo-ved. Therefore there is no wasted effort and productivity is correspondingly improved.GPS informationcan help to notifythe operatorhow the bladeshould be placed.Material evidenceAs shown in SfinX, metal will increasingly be replaced as a component material by compo-sites. This is because they are resistant to the environment and can be relatively easily repai-red (they are also generally lighter; can be molded into more interesting shapes). Plastics, meanwhile, are lower cost, can be painted to a higher specification and –in line with Volvo’s core values –environmentally friendly plastics are becoming available, helping manufacturers meet their targets for recyclability.Force fieldThe juncture between the undercarriage and superstructure would eschew the current arrangement of a large roller bearing. Instead the SfinX exca-vator hovers on an electro-magnetic field. The advantages of this are that there would be zero friction and better control of the speed and torque turning of the superstructure.Operator environmentThe cab on the SfinX excavator is cantilevered to improve all round visibility. But it can also tilt the cab, move it away from the machine to improve visi-bility (as some waste handling machines already do) – or be left on the ground entirely. This latter attribute is for the remote control of the machine, such as where the operator cannot safely work on the machine (such as close to high radioactivity or if the machine is working underwater). In the morning the cab comes down to meet the operator, it then opens the door and says ‘hello, how are you today?’! Having a detachable cab necessitates having cameras on the excavator to be able to monitor progress from the remote cab. Screens inside the cab will have a good view of the work area. It is not inconceivable that operators of the future will have to wear fighter p ilot-typ e helmets with virtual reality p rojections onto the screen.The aerospace industry is leading the way here.THE SHAPE OF THINGS TO COME7The road to reality?Is this how the future will look?Of course, not all glances into the future have proven correct. Even if SfinX is not exactlyhow Volvo’s excavators look in the 2020s, if only a small number of its ideas come tofruition, then the project will have proven to be a success. The SfinX concept is a statementof Volvo CE’s intention to be at the forefront of technological development – producingmachines that are not only highly productive but also people and environment friendly.21 1 669 2739 - HQR 2004.07 - EnglishPrinted in Belgium。
